Nintendo Wii 2 Controller Has 6-inch Touchscreen Display
Jun 4th

Nikkei newspaper in Japan has confirmed that the new Nintendo Wii 2 controller will feature a 6-inch touchscreen display with a tablet-like functionality and a built-in camera. The console was developed as a response to the growth of the tablet and smartphone market. Apparently, Nintendo’s hope is that a controller that works as a self-sufficient handheld system will appeal to casual gamers. The console is slated for release in 2012. [1Up and IGN]

Gemini FirstMix USB DJ Controller
Jun 1st

Gemini is ready to release the highly anticipated FirstMix USB DJ controller for aspiring DJs. The award winning FirstMix connects to a laptop or desktop PC via a USB port, allowing you to DJ with your iTunes or other music library by effortlessly navigating through folders and tracks with the browse function. The device provides a pair of touch-sensitive jog wheels, 2-band EQ and effects and a cross-fader. The Gemini FirstMix comes with a copy of MixVibes CROSS LE with support for M4A, AIFF, WAV, MP3, FLAC and OGG audio files. For your info, the FirstMix is the newest addition to Gemini’s Digital DJ Controller line. It is currently available for $99.95. [Max Borges]

Rumor: Wii HD controller has a camera too?
May 20th
Nintendo’s set to announce its Wii successor, codenamed Project Cafe next month at E3, but that hasn’t stopped the rumor mill from speculating on what features the controller will have. Besides a six-inch touchscreen, the new controller is now said to have a camera.
